Crochet Granny Square Christmas Stocking

The Crochet Granny Square Christmas stocking is a delightful and charming addition to your holiday décor. Its intricate design and cozy feel make it a perfect handmade touch for the festive season. Craft Supplies:

  • Worsted weight yarn*, red, green & white
  • Crochet hook, size G or H
  • Yarn needle
  • Needle & thread
  • Felt

*You will use less than one skein of each color

Make 8 granny squares as follows:

With white yarn Ch 5; join with a slst to form a ring.

Round 1: Ch 3, 2 dc in ring* ch1, 3dc in ring. Repeat from * 2 more times. Ch 1 join with slst to 3rd ch

Round 2: Ch 3, 2 dc in corner space * 3dc in next space, ch 1, 3 dc in same space. Repeat from * 2 more times, 3 dc in beginning space, ch 1, join with slst to 3rd ch (of beginning ch 3)

Change to green yarn.

Round 3: Ch 3, 2 dc in corner space, *3 dc in next space, 3 dc in corner sp, ch 1, 3 dc in same corner space. Repeat from * 2 more times, 3dc in next sp, 3 dc in beg sp, ch1, join with slst to 3rd ch (of beg ch 3)

Round 4: Ch 3, 2 dc in corner sp, * 3 dc in next sp, 3 dc in next sp, 3 dc in corner sp, ch 1, 3 dc in same corner sp. Repeat from * 2 more times, 3 dc in next sp, 3dc in next sp, 3 dc in beg sp, ch1, join with slst to 3rd ch (of beg ch 3)

Change to red yarn.

Round 5: Ch 3, 2 dc in corner sp, * 3 dc in next sp, 3 dc in next sp, 3 dc in next sp, 3 dc in corner sp, ch 1, 3 dc in same corner sp. Repeat from * 2 more times, 3 dc in next sp, 3 dc in next sp, 3dc in next sp, 3 dc in beg sp, ch1, join with slst to 3rd ch (of beg ch 3)

Round 6: Ch 3, 2 dc in corner sp, * 3 dc in next sp, 3 dc in next sp, 3dc in next sp, 3 dc in next sp, 3 dc in corner sp, ch 1, 3 dc in same corner sp. Repeat from * 2 more times, 3 dc in next sp, 3 dc in next sp, 3dc in next sp, 3dc in next sp, 3 dc in beg sp, ch1, join with slst to 3rd ch (of beg ch 3)

. Fasten off , weave loose ends into your work and cut off any extra yarn.

Assemble the Stocking:

  • Line up two squares on top of each other with right sides facing each other. Whip stitch one of the sides together. Open up (unfold) the two squares. Join a third square to the first two in the same way so that you have 3 squares in a straight line.
  • Repeat this process with three of the other squares so that you have two straight lines made up of 3 squares each.
  • Lay both of the joined sets of granny squares vertically on your work surface face up.
  • Place one of the remaining squares on top of the bottom most square with right sides facing each other.
  • Whip stitch the right side of one of the sets of granny squares and whip stitch the left side of the other set. Unfold so that you have an L shape and a backwards L shape. It is very important that one piece be the mirror image of the other instead of being identical so when you join the front and back both right sides will be facing out.
  • Trace one of the crochet stocking pieces onto a double layer of felt. Place the crochet pieces aside while you make the liner.
  • Cut out the stocking pieces from the felt. Pin the two layers together and either hand or machine stitch the two felt stocking pieces together leaving the top unstitched. Place the liner aside.
  • Place the two crochet stocking pieces one on top of the other with right sides facing outward.
  • Using red yarn, whip stitch the two stocking pieces together leaving the top opened.
  • Slip the felt lining inside the crochet stocking.
  • Hand stitch the liner to the inside of the stocking. The liner should be slightly shorter than the stocking.

Make a hanger:

  • Ch 20; turn; dc in each ch, fasten off.

Fold the hanger in half an stitch it to the inside top corner of the stocking.
